IMAP Download All Email One at a Time

Demonstrates how to download every email in an IMAP mailbox one at a time as a MIME string or as an email object. (The MIME contains the full contents of the email including all attachments.)

PureBasic
IncludeFile "CkEmail.pb"
IncludeFile "CkImap.pb"

Procedure ChilkatExample()

    success.i = 0

    imap.i = CkImap::ckCreate()
    If imap.i = 0
        Debug "Failed to create object."
        ProcedureReturn
    EndIf

    ; This example requires the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
    ; See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.

    ; Connect to an IMAP server.
    ; Use TLS
    CkImap::setCkSsl(imap, 1)
    CkImap::setCkPort(imap, 993)
    success = CkImap::ckConnect(imap,"imap.example.com")
    If success = 0
        Debug CkImap::ckLastErrorText(imap)
        CkImap::ckDispose(imap)
        ProcedureReturn
    EndIf

    ; Login
    success = CkImap::ckLogin(imap,"myLogin","myPassword")
    If success = 0
        Debug CkImap::ckLastErrorText(imap)
        CkImap::ckDispose(imap)
        ProcedureReturn
    EndIf

    ; Select an IMAP mailbox
    success = CkImap::ckSelectMailbox(imap,"Inbox")
    If success = 0
        Debug CkImap::ckLastErrorText(imap)
        CkImap::ckDispose(imap)
        ProcedureReturn
    EndIf

    ; Once the mailbox is selected, the NumMessages property
    ; will contain the number of messages in the mailbox.
    ; You may loop from 1 to NumMessages to
    ; fetch each message by sequence number.

    bUid.i = 0
    mimeStr.s
    i.i
    n.i = CkImap::ckNumMessages(imap)
    For i = 1 To n

        ; Download the email by sequence number.
        mimeStr = CkImap::ckFetchSingleAsMime(imap,i,bUid)

        ; ... your application may process each MIME string...
    Next

    ; An alternative is to download each email in the form of an
    ; email object, like this:
    email.i = CkEmail::ckCreate()
    If email.i = 0
        Debug "Failed to create object."
        ProcedureReturn
    EndIf

    For i = 1 To n

        ; Download the email by sequence number.
        success = CkImap::ckFetchEmail(imap,0,i,bUid,email)

        ; ... your application may process the email object...

    Next

    ; Disconnect from the IMAP server.
    success = CkImap::ckDisconnect(imap)


    CkImap::ckDispose(imap)
    CkEmail::ckDispose(email)


    ProcedureReturn
EndProcedure
